Hi3559/Hi3556V100 SDK: 开机画面与声音集成教程

需积分: 31 80 下载量 126 浏览量 更新于2024-08-09 收藏 1.17MB PDF 举报
《高等几何》一书中提到的开机画面和声音集成技术,针对的是海思Hi3559V100和Hi3556V100芯片的应用。这部分内容主要关注如何有效地将这些多媒体功能整合到操作系统中,以提升设备的用户体验。 首先,集成选择上,作者推荐将开机画面和声音放置于Huawei LiteOS中,而不是u-boot。这是因为LiteOS专为媒体业务设计,这样可以减少移植工作量,降低代码复杂性。将这些功能放入LiteOS的优点包括:1)易于集成,只需调用预定义接口即可;2)启动速度快,播放延迟相较于u-boot更小,不会显著影响后续流程;3)声音输出与系统初始化可以并行处理,提高效率。 具体实现流程如下: 4.2.2.1 开启步骤: 1. 媒体初始化:这是集成的第一步,包括VB(Video Buffering)的初始化以及整个系统的设置,确保硬件和驱动支持正确播放画面和声音。 2. 系统设置:配置必要的参数和资源,如音频解码器设置、屏幕分辨率等。 3. 调用相关API:在LiteOS的框架下,调用预先编写好的API来显示开机画面和播放声音,确保功能的正确执行。 4.2.2.2 注意事项: 应用到实际产品时,开发者需要根据产品的特性和需求调整这个样本流程,可能涉及定制化的功能扩展或接口适配。此外,SDK版本(如Hi3559V100R003)的更新可能会影响某些细节,因此开发者需要查阅最新的SDK文档以获取最新信息。 对于使用Hi3559V100和Hi3556V100的工程师来说,这章内容提供了宝贵的指导,无论是技术支持还是软件开发人员,都可以从中了解到如何高效地利用SDK构建支持开机画面和声音的双系统应用。同时,文档还强调了版权和保密信息的重要性,提醒开发者在使用过程中必须遵循相关规定,尊重知识产权。